WebThe average bus ticket from Whistler to Vancouver costs around $23 for departures 15 days prior. To save money and be sure you have the best seat, it's a good idea to buy your bus tickets from Whistler to Vancouver, as early as possible. The best time to find and book cheap bus tickets is to book at least 15 days in advance. WebCantrip Shuttle fares for a shared ride are as follows: YVR to Whistler: $45. YVR to Horseshoe Bay: $45. The prices are the same if you’re traveling to the airport.
